Economist calls for enabling environment on taxation in Kwara

Date: 2016-02-15

An economist and former Accountant General of Kwara State, Alhaji Tunde Ahmed Abdulkareem has enjoined the State Government to create an enabling environment for citizens of the state to earn taxable income to meet up with the tax system of the present administration.

Alhaji Abdulareem expressed this view in Ilorin ,the state capital while answering questions on a Radio Kwara personality programme ,Playing Host.

He observed that the people who are taxed mostly are civil servants who pay through Pay As You Earn PAYE and therefore urged the State Revenue Internal Service to monitor other sectors and collect the taxes meant for the coffers of the state government promptly.

The former Accountant General observed that the new system of tax collection is the governments legitimate right to levy citizens or groups to collect taxes adding that it would go along way to block loopholes of tax invaders .

Alhaji Abdulkareem also described the Treasury Single Account TSA introduced by the Federal Government as a good and welcome development but, however ,recalled that the TSA is not new in the country stressing that in the past ,all revenues collected and arc rude by the various governments were paid into the state treasuries but that the coming of subsequent military regimes changed the system of revenue collection and income payable to states.

According to him,before now, all revenues and income of the federal and state governments were directly under the supervision of the Accountant General of the federation or that of the State as no agency then had powers to spend government funds and said it was in the right direction that the government had reverted to the former system of single treasury.
